- Product name
- Anti-PDCD1
- Antibody type
- Polyclonal
- Description
- Polyclonal Antibody against Human PDCD1, Gene description: programmed cell death 1, Alternative Gene Names: CD279, hSLE1, PD1, SLEB2, Validated applications: IHC, WB, Uniprot ID: Q15116, Storage: Store at +4°C for short term storage. Long time storage is recommended at -20°C.
